Elmdene Int600s & Gardtec 872

Featured Replies

Hello,

Wiring up the Int Sounder and before I "play" I'm wondering if someone could clarify?

The alarm is all setup, PIRs etc are working and we've completed a "test" period for the false alarms,

After a month of no false alarms, we think it's fault free.

I'm hooking up the internal sounder but the install guide for the sounder is vague.

It's got 5 connections (ignoring the 2 for the internal battery).

H+ & H- are 0v and 12V Cntrl Panel which are fine.

R- - 0v activates sounder

M- 0v activates buzzer

RTN - Tamper Return

These three I'm not 100% sure of. I know the RTN goes into the SAB TMP on the Panel.

I think the R- goes into the Bell Hold on the panel.

But I'm not sure where the M- goes on the panel? Is that the SPKR on the Panel?

R- is a switched negative input, if you connect it to Bell Hold it will sound continuously.

It should be connected to the switched - bell output on the panel, I can't remember how this is labelled with Gardtec stuff but may be S- or similar.

The M terminal is a switched negative which will give a lower volume output for entry exit tones, not sure if your panel has an output which supports that.

I presume you already have an external bell connected to the panel?

If so, you can't connect the tamper return straight into the SAB tamp terminal on the panel.

R- goes to Bell -

You can't connect the M terminal as the speaker output on your panel is designed for a proper loudspeaker, not a voltage driven sounder like your Elmdene.
